Observations from Tuesday night's 93-79 victory over the Boston Celtics at AmericanAirlines Arena:

-- LeBron James just keeps on going, his rebounding providing a needed boost in this one.

-- No, the Celtics do not have an answer. Not with Paul Pierce playing on a bum knee.

-- And what the tag-team with Dwyane Wade wasn't of the level that it was against the Pacers, it was more than enough.

-- But this also was about the supporting cast.

-- Mario Chalmers didn't enough to offset enough of Rajon Rondo. And that's all you can ask.

-- Mike Miller and Shane Battier hit shots when the Heat needed them to hit shots.

-- Joel Anthony was big off the bench.

I would search for my halftime post, but I'm too lazy.

I called the blowout at halftime. You could see from the opening moment that this game was ours. I told you damn doubters than this series would be ours even without Bosh. We don't need him for this series, we outclass this team severely.

Give Spo credit again. He made some excellent adjustments that only held the Celtics to 33 points in the second half. I think we only held KG to 6 shots in the second half.

Great rebounding effort. Excellent job defending the paint with blocked shots. 42 points in the paint too.

We need to control the turnovers even more, force more turnovers from them and hit those open shots. We're good this series. Rio and Miller were the key support tonight. Let's get 3 more. PEACE.
